The Florence and Ray Sponberg Endowment Fund is accepting applications for its annual scholarship for students in the Political Science or History Department. Florence Sponberg is an emeriti faculty member of the Department of English at Minnesota State University.
One scholarship of $600.00 can be awarded to a female undergraduate or graduate student (who qualifies) with Political Science, History, International Relations, or Social Studies (Political Science) majors, who can demonstrate that they are contributing actively to the promotion of peace in the world or by submitting evidence of active participation in the Kessel Institute or another peace-promoting organization. Applicants should plan to enroll as full-time students at MSU in the Fall Semester of 2008.
Applicants must submit a current transcript and a completed application. The winner will be announced as soon after March 28th as possible. The award will be in the form of a $600.00 tuition payment for 2008-2009.
